Grand Theft has an RTP of 95.63%, which is average compared to the industry standard of ~96%. For every $100 wagered, the theoretical return is $95.63 over extended sessions.
Grand Theft has Medium volatility, meaning it offers a balanced mix of frequency and size.
The maximum win potential is 8,325x your total bet.
